Available Storage Options in Farnborough
Residents and businesses in Farnborough have various storage options. Self-storage offers private units with flexible access, perfect for those who need to retrieve items on short notice or adjust unit sizes as needed.
Mobile storage is another option. A secure container is delivered to your doorstep for loading at your own pace. Once ready, it's collected and stored at a warehouse, saving you the hassle of van rentals or multiple trips.
Businesses may need storage for archiving documents or excess stock, with climate-controlled units protecting sensitive materials. Larger enterprises can opt for warehousing to store pallets or heavy machinery, providing scalable solutions for growing needs.
Key Considerations for Selection
Choosing the right storage unit involves more than just comparing prices. The size of the unit should match your needs; paying for excess space is wasteful, but cramming items into a small unit can cause damage. If you're unsure, ask the facility staff for a size estimate based on your home's contents.
Security is another critical factor. A good facility should have comprehensive security measures. Look for 24-hour CCTV, individual unit alarms, and gated entry with unique access codes to ensure your possessions are protected.
Accessibility is also key. Some facilities offer 24/7 access, while others have limited business hours. If you need to access your items outside of a standard 9-to-5, confirm their schedule before you commit. Finally, consider the total cost. Ask about potential hidden fees, such as mandatory insurance or the required purchase of a padlock, to ensure the price fits your budget.

Maximising Your Rented Space
To make the most of your rental, pack strategically. Stack boxes vertically to use the unit’s full height, placing heavy boxes at the bottom and lighter, fragile items on top to prevent damage. Use uniform boxes for safer, more stable stacking.
Dismantle furniture like beds and tables to save space, and keep screws and bolts in a labeled bag taped to each piece for easy reassembly. Protect delicate items with bubble wrap and cover furniture with dust sheets to prevent damage during storage. .
Plan your unit layout by placing frequently needed items near the door. Avoid having to dig through everything by creating a clear inventory list to track what’s in each box.
